For 2017, the total budget of the Ministry of Energy, Tourism and Digital Agenda amounts to 5,264 million euros, which is practically the same amount compared to the adjusted budget of 2016.
The Energy area has 4,247 million euros, which according to the Minister of Energy, Tourism and Digital Agenda, Álvaro Nadal, will serve to balance the tariff deficit, support the social and economic fabric of the coal sector and promote efficiency policies. energy and use of renewables.
- In the new lines of work On which the next actions will focus within the field of energy and energy efficiency are several sectors: Aid for energy efficiency in the field of municipal lighting (28.7 million).
- Transport aid (3.7 million)
- Aid for buildings and infrastructure of the General State Administration, endowed with 95 million euros.
- Subsidies for unique projects of local entities with less than 20,000 inhabitants, endowed with 336 million euros.
In this sense, the minister has indicated that energy efficiency must be one of the central pillars of energy policy and the Government is being very active in this matter through the National Energy Efficiency Fund. He also highlighted that the Institute for Energy Diversification and Saving (IDAE) has been named Intermediate Body for the management of actions within the low-carbon economy objective of the Sustainable Growth Operational Program 2014-2020. The IDAE will manage more than 2,000 million FEDER aid for actions such as energy efficiency, thermal renewables, wind farms in the Canary Islands, links between the islands and the peninsula, promotion of renewable R&D&I and unique projects by local entities.
